Transaction 5040231692c74b029372fb995039c802f22bceb83fedf352246fa074bfebf757

1 Input
2 Outputs
  • 5040231692c74b029372fb995039c802f22bceb83fedf352246fa074bfebf757:0
  • value  1730000
    address  1PE4pSJ6RsRFKtfacSgA347sWNui4aMrKN
  • 5040231692c74b029372fb995039c802f22bceb83fedf352246fa074bfebf757:1
  • value  24500088
    address  1354X97o1vfC8fR8GxGiBeDtMuRdkXT2UB